What are Dumplings?

what are dumplings

Dumplings are based on dough and they have different types of fillings on the inside – simple as that.

The dough is standard and only includes water, salt and flour, nothing else.

But then, the flour can make the difference.

For instance, most dumplings are based on classic wheat flour.

But then, in China, local chefs rely on a cocktail of tapioca starch and wheat.

Unless you eat dumplings on a daily basis, you would not be able to tell the difference though.

Now, things change when it comes to the actual fillings.

Just like the bao bun – another common and similar food in Asian cuisines, dumplings can range widely in taste due to the fillings.

You can opt for something sweet, for example.

However, most people associate dumplings with salty aromas.

They are rich in savor and can be enhanced with different sauces.

What Do Dumplings Taste Like?

what do dumplings taste like

Figuring out what dumplings taste like is difficult because there are lots of choices out there.

For instance, a dumpling filled with beef is obviously different from a dumpling filled with jam.

Different types of dumplings are unique.

All in all, they usually go in two categories – sweet or salty.

Salty dumplings are more popular, as most people have them filled with different types of meats or vegetables.

In this case, the taste is often enhanced with soy sauce, yet other types of sauces are also accepted.

Saltiness is often enhanced with a bit of spiciness too.

In fact, many types of dumplings have a slightly spicy flavor, even if it is not too obvious.

The taste is not the only element making dumplings so popular all over the world though, but also the texture.

When fried properly, their sides get a bit crispy, which feels great with the soft middle.

That being said, the way you prepare dumplings will also affect the taste – both directly and indirectly.

For example, the fried variety will have a more intense flavor.

On the other hand, boiled or steamed dumplings are milder in flavor and taste.

Obviously, the way you cook them will also affect the texture – frying them will give them that unique crispy texture on the sides.

How to Prepare and Cook Dumplings?

how to prepare and cook dumplings

Based on the info available on SteveHacks, there are lots of different ways to prepare dumplings, as well as a plethora of recipes to mix them in.

The dough is usually homemade, yet you can also buy it in commerce – fillings are already included then and there are not too many options for you to change.

So, your preferences dictate the final result.

In terms of fillings, you can get something sweet or salty.

Feel free to use your imagination – there are no limits whatsoever.

Different cuisines have dumplings in different flavors.

Pork, chicken and beef are just some of the most popular choices.

Then, you also have shrimp or lamb.

Vegetarians can use carrots or perhaps a mix of spinach and ricotta.

Interested in something sweet? Use fruits instead.

Now, in terms of cooking dumplings, you have more options.

Steaming or boiling them is the clean way – it is healthier, but also not as flavorful as other options.

On the other hand, pan or deep frying dumplings will give you a different texture because the exterior gets a bit crispy.

Plus, oily dumplings simply taste better, yet they are a bit unhealthy.

The filling and sauce – if any – will make the difference, so you may not always be able to tell how they were cooked.
